Fisherman's Cabin On The Bay

3 3
cabin , Norfolk
This Norfolk cabin is located just a short block from the marina and a couple of blocks from the Chesapeake Bay's sandy beaches, offering easy access to waterfront activities and attractions. Guests consistently rate this rental as "very good," highlighting its comfortable accommodations and prime location.
The single-story home features 1450 square feet of space, comfortably accommodating up to seven guests in its three bedrooms and one bathroom. Enjoy modern amenities like a large 65" Smart TV, high-speed WiFi, a fully equipped kitchen, a charcoal grill, a fireplace, and a spacious garden perfect for relaxing and enjoying the beautiful sunsets over the Chesapeake Bay.
